Private Function ShapesMatch(shpShape As Shape, shpModel As Shape, _
                    Optional CheckFill As Boolean = True, _
                    Optional CheckOutline As Boolean = True, _
                    Optional CheckOutlineColor As Boolean = True, _
                    Optional CheckOutlineLength As Boolean = True, _
                    Optional CheckSize As Boolean = False, _
                    Optional CheckWHratio As Boolean = False, _
                    Optional CheckType As Boolean = True, _
                    Optional CountNodes As Boolean = False, _
                    Optional CountSegments As Boolean = False, _
                    Optional CountPaths As Boolean = False, _
                    Optional CheckIndiv As Boolean = False) As Boolean
    
    'Sizes "match" if they differ by less than one per cent
    Dim ToleranceSize As Double     '面积大小允许波动
    ToleranceSize = Me.TextBox1 / 100  '面积大小允许波动,以百分比为单位
    
    Dim ToleranceLength As Double   '线长允许波动
    ToleranceLength = Me.TextBox2 / 100 '长度允许波动,以百分比为单位
    
    Dim ToleranceNodesCount As Long  '节点数量允许波动,以 点 单位
    ToleranceNodesCount = Me.TextBox3 '节点数量允许波动,以 点 单位
    
    Dim ToleranceSubPathsCount As Long  '子路径 子线段 允许波动,以 条 为单位
    ToleranceSubPathsCount = Me.TextBox4 '子路径 子线段 允许波动,以 条 为单位
    
    Dim ToleranceWHratio As Double  '长宽比 允许波动,以 百分比 为单位
    ToleranceWHratio = Me.TextBox5  '长宽比 允许波动,以 百分比 为单位
    
    Dim ToleranceSegmentsCount As Long  '线段数 允许波动,以 个 为单位
    ToleranceSegmentsCount = Me.TextBox6 '线段数 允许波动,以 个 为单位
        
    'Object Variables.        'Reference to:
    Dim clrModel As Color           'color features of model shape,
    Dim clrShape As Color           'color features of shape to be tested
    Dim fillModel As Fill           'fill style of model shape,
    Dim outlnModel As Outline       'outline style of model shape,
    Dim crvModel As Curve           'Bezier curve of model shape,
    Dim crvShape As Curve           'Bezier curve of shape to be tested,
    Dim fntModel As StructFontProperties  'font properties of model text shape,
    Dim trgModel As text            'general text properties of model shape.
    Dim spath As SubPath, opath As SubPath
    Dim j As Integer
    
    'Simple Variables.              Storage of:
    Dim dblWidth As Double              'width of a shape,
    Dim dblHeight As Double             'height of a shape,
    Dim lngShapeType As cdrShapeType    'code for type of shape to be tested,
    Dim lngModelType As cdrShapeType    'code for the type of a model shape,
    Dim lngType As Long                 'code for the type of a fill, color,
                                        'or outline.
                                        
    
                                        'Does the SHAPE match the MODEL ?
                                        'Exit immediately on any mismatch.
    With shpShape
        lngShapeType = .Type            'Same basic TYPE of shape ?
        lngModelType = shpModel.Type
        
        If CheckType Then If lngShapeType <> lngModelType Then GoTo NoMatch
                                        'A GROUP ? delegate to GroupsMatch()
'        If lngShapeType = cdrGroupShape Then
'            ShapesMatch = GroupsMatch(shpShape, shpModel, CheckSize, _
'                                CountNodes, CountPaths)
'            Exit Function
'        End If

                                        'Does SIZE count ? Is so, are the
        If CheckSize Then               'size differences significant ?
            dblWidth = shpModel.SizeWidth
            If Abs(.SizeWidth - dblWidth) > (dblWidth * _
                 ToleranceSize) Then GoTo NoMatch
            dblHeight = shpModel.SizeHeight
            If Abs(.SizeHeight - dblHeight) > (dblHeight * _
                ToleranceSize) Then GoTo NoMatch
        End If
        
        If CheckWHratio Then               'size width and height ratio differences significant ?
            dblWidth = shpModel.SizeWidth
            dblHeight = shpModel.SizeHeight
            If Abs(.SizeHeight / .SizeWidth - dblHeight / dblWidth) > (dblHeight / dblWidth * ToleranceWHratio) Then GoTo NoMatch
        End If
        

            If CountNodes Or CountPaths Or CheckOutlineLength Or CountSegments Then
                                        'Only Curves can match ...
                If lngShapeType <> cdrCurveShape Then GoTo NoMatch
                
                Set crvShape = .Curve
                Set crvModel = shpModel.Curve
                
                'If CheckIndiv Then '逐条子路径比较
                    'If Abs(crvShape.SubPaths.Count - crvModel.SubPaths.Count) <> 0 Then GoTo NoMatch
                    'For j = 1 To crvShape.SubPaths.Count
                            'If Abs(crvShape.SubPath(j).Nodes.Count - crvModel.SubPath(j).Nodes.Count) > ToleranceNodesCount Then GoTo NoMatch
                     
                     'Next j
                
                If CountPaths Then      'Do the PATH counts match ?
                    
                    If VersionMajor > 12 Then 'GDG ##########################################
                        If Abs(crvShape.SubPaths.Count - crvModel.SubPaths.Count) > ToleranceSubPathsCount Then GoTo NoMatch
                        'MsgBox "subpaths1: " & crvShape.SubPaths.Count & "subpaths2: " & crvModel.SubPaths.Count
                    Else
                        If Abs(crvShape.SubPathCount - crvModel.SubPathCount) > ToleranceSubPathsCount Then GoTo NoMatch
                    End If 'GDG #############################################################
                    
                End If
                
                
                 
                 
                If CountNodes Then      'Do the NODE counts match ?
                
                    If VersionMajor > 12 Then 'GDG ##########################################
                        If Abs(crvShape.Nodes.Count - crvModel.Nodes.Count) > ToleranceNodesCount Then GoTo NoMatch
                    Else
                        If Abs(crvShape.NodeCount - crvModel.NodeCount) > ToleranceNodesCount Then GoTo NoMatch
                    End If 'GDG #############################################################
                    
                End If
                
                If CountSegments Then      'Do the Segments counts match ?
                
                    If VersionMajor > 12 Then 'GDG ##########################################
                        If Abs(crvShape.Segments.Count - crvModel.Segments.Count) > ToleranceSegmentsCount Then GoTo NoMatch
                    Else
                        If Abs(crvShape.SegmentCount - crvModel.SegmentCount) > ToleranceSegmentsCount Then GoTo NoMatch
                    End If 'GDG #############################################################
                    
                End If
        
                
                
                If CheckOutlineLength Then      'Do the curve length match ?
                
                    If VersionMajor > 12 Then 'GDG ##########################################
                        If Abs(crvShape.Length - crvModel.Length) > crvModel.Length * ToleranceLength Then GoTo NoMatch
                        'MsgBox "subpaths1: " & crvShape.SubPaths.Count & "subpaths2: " & crvModel.SubPaths.Count
                    Else
                        If Abs(crvShape.Length - crvModel.Length) > crvModel.Length * ToleranceLength Then GoTo NoMatch
                    End If 'GDG #############################################################
                    
                End If
            End If
        If CheckFill Then
            Set fillModel = shpModel.Fill
            With .Fill                  'Is the FILL type the same ?
                lngType = .Type
                If lngType <> shpModel.Fill.Type Then GoTo NoMatch
                If lngType = cdrUniformFill Then
'Does the uniform fill match ?
                    If VersionMajor > 12 Then 'GDG ##########################################
                        'GDG ##########################################
                        Dim col1 As New Color
                        col1.CopyAssign .UniformColor
                        Dim col2 As New Color
                        col2.CopyAssign shpModel.Fill.UniformColor
                        'GDG ##########################################
                        If col1.IsSame(col2) = False Then GoTo NoMatch
                    Else
                        Set clrModel = fillModel.UniformColor
                        lngType = .UniformColor.Type
                        If lngType <> clrModel.Type Then GoTo NoMatch
                        If .UniformColor.Name(True) <> clrModel.Name(True) Then GoTo NoMatch
                    End If  'GDG #############################################################
                End If
            End With
        End If
        
        
        
        If CheckOutline Then            '(Groups have no outline)
            If lngShapeType <> cdrGroupShape Then
                Set outlnModel = shpModel.Outline
                If Not outlnModel Is Nothing Then
                    With .Outline
                        lngType = .Type
                        If lngType <> outlnModel.Type Then GoTo NoMatch
                                                
                        If lngType > 0 Then     'Does the shape have an OUTLINE ?
                                                'Same LINE WIDTH ?
                            If .Width <> outlnModel.Width Then GoTo NoMatch
                                                'Matching LINE COLOR ?
'                            Set clrShape = .Color
'                            lngType = clrShape.Type
'                            Set clrModel = outlnModel.Color
'                            If lngType <> clrModel.Type Then GoTo NoMatch
'                            If clrShape.Name(True) <> clrModel.Name(True) Then GoTo NoMatch
                        End If
                    End With
                End If
            End If
        End If
        
        
        If CheckOutlineColor Then            '(Groups have no outline)
            If lngShapeType <> cdrGroupShape Then
 
               
                Set outlnModel = shpModel.Outline
                If Not outlnModel Is Nothing Then
                    
                    With .Outline
                        lngType = .Type
                        If lngType <> outlnModel.Type Then GoTo NoMatch
                                                
                        If lngType > 0 Then     'Does the shape have an OUTLINE ?
                                                'Matching LINE COLOR ?
                            
                            If VersionMajor > 12 Then 'GDG ##########################################
                                'GDG ##########################################
                                Dim col3 As New Color
                                col3.CopyAssign .Color
                                Dim col4 As New Color
                                col4.CopyAssign shpModel.Outline.Color
                                'GDG ##########################################
                                If col3.IsSame(col4) = False Then GoTo NoMatch
                            Else
                                Set clrShape = .Color
                                lngType = clrShape.Type
                                Set clrModel = outlnModel.Color
                                If lngType <> clrModel.Type Then GoTo NoMatch
                                If clrShape.Name(True) <> clrModel.Name(True) _
                                    Then GoTo NoMatch
                            End If
                        End If
                    End With
                End If
            End If
        End If
        
    End With
    
    ShapesMatch = True
    Exit Function
    
NoMatch:
    ShapesMatch = False
    
NoMatchExit:
    ShapesMatch = False
    Exit Function
End Function

Private Function FlatShapeList(TopLevelShapes As Shapes) As Collection
    
    'Object Variables.          Reference to:
    Dim shpTopLevel As Shape        'a top-level shape,
    Dim shpInGroup As Shape         'a shape inside a group,
    Dim clnAllShapes As Collection  'our list of all members and
                                    'descendants of TopLevelShapes.
                                       
    If TopLevelShapes.Count Then
        Set clnAllShapes = New Collection
        For Each shpTopLevel In TopLevelShapes
                                    'Add shape to list, keyed under
                                    'a string version of its unique ID
             clnAllShapes.Add shpTopLevel
                                    'If the shape is a group, then
                                    'also gather all its descendants
                                    'and add them to the list.
            If shpTopLevel.Type = cdrGroupShape Then
                For Each shpInGroup In ShapesInGroup(shpTopLevel)
               clnAllShapes.Add shpInGroup
                Next
            End If
        Next
        Set FlatShapeList = clnAllShapes  'Return the assembled collection.
    Else
        Set FlatShapeList = Nothing
    End If
End Function

Private Function ShapesInGroup(GroupShape As Shape) As Collection

    'Object Variables.              Reference to:
    Dim shpsInGroup As Shapes           'the set of shapes inside a group,
    Dim shpInGroup As Shape             'a particular shape in a group,
    Dim shpNested As Shape              'a shape inside a sub-group,
    Dim clnShapeList As Collection      'our list of all nested shapes.
    
    If GroupShape.Type = cdrGroupShape Then
        Set shpsInGroup = GroupShape.Shapes 'Get a reference to the
                                            'shapes in this group.
        Set clnShapeList = New Collection
        For Each shpInGroup In shpsInGroup
            clnShapeList.Add shpInGroup     'Add all shapes in the group to
                                            'our main collection.
            If shpInGroup.Type = cdrGroupShape Then
                                            'Recurse to get nested shapes.
                For Each shpNested In ShapesInGroup(shpInGroup)
                    clnShapeList.Add shpNested
                Next
            End If
        Next
        Set ShapesInGroup = clnShapeList    'Return the assembled collection.
    Else
        Set ShapesInGroup = Nothing         'Release the memory if the
    End If                                  'collection is not needed
End Function
